Savory Avocado and Bell Pepper Frittata
ingredients
- 1/2 large red bell pepper, diced
- 1/2 medium onion, finely chopped
- 1 ripe avocado, peeled, pitted, and diced
- 4 large eggs
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 tablespoon olive oil
- 2 tablespoons shredded cheddar cheese
- Fresh cilantro, for garnish
steps
- 1.
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- 2.
In a medium ovenproof sk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
- 3.
Sauté the diced red bell pepper and chopped onion until softened, about 5 minutes.
- 4.
In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, and black pepper.
- 5.
Add the diced avocado to the egg mixture, gently folding to combine.
- 6.
Pour the egg and avocado mixture over the sautéed vegetables in the skillet. Stir briefly to distribute the ingredients evenly.
- 7.
Cook the frittata on the stovetop for 3-4 minutes, or until the edges start to set.
- 8.
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ese over the top of the frittata, then transfer the skillet to the preheated oven.
- 9.
Bake for 12-15 minutes or until the center of the frittata is set and the cheese is melted and golden.
- 10.
Remove from the oven and let it cool slightly.
- 11.
Garnish with fresh cilantro.
- 12.
Slice and serve warm or refrigerate for later enjoyment.
